Output 06881cf91a0008de8088615fa025656029b380a8000bcf2bf22651ca4a634446:1

value
740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 728988ff30f09981171aaabe67588ab13e32015c OP_EQUAL
address
3C8diXDRPdsnQ47nL5AbSVYTtJus9C36rE
transaction
06881cf91a0008de8088615fa025656029b380a8000bcf2bf22651ca4a634446
confirmations
474014
spent
true